Section 34-8A-13 – Collection of fines, fees or costs.
A judgment and sentence issued by the Bernalillo county metropolitan court that includes an assessment of fines, fees or costs shall constitute a money judgment that may be enforced in the same manner as a civil judgment in the district court. Section 34-8A-15 – Metropolitan court; electronic services fee.
A metropolitan court may charge and collect from persons who use electronic services an electronic services fee in an amount established by supreme court rule. Proceeds from the electronic services fee shall be remitted to the administrative office of the courts for deposit in the electronic services fund. History: Laws 2009, ch. 112, § 5. […]
Section 34-8A-4.1 – Metropolitan court judges; terms of office.
The term of office for each judge of the metropolitan court is four years. Judges shall be appointed, elected and retained in accordance with Article 6 of the constitution of New Mexico. Section 34-8A-4.2 – Appointment as special master, arbitrator or metropolitan court judge pro tempore; compensation.
A. The chief metropolitan court judge may appoint a retired metropolitan court judge, with the retired judge’s consent, to serve as a special master, an arbitrator or a metropolitan court judge pro tempore, subject to money available in the metropolitan court operating budget.
